A New Axis in the AI Race
For much of the past three years, the dominant framing of artificial intelligence competition has been geopolitical: the United States versus China. But a wave of recent model releases suggests the more consequential divide may now be technological philosophy rather than national origin — open-source versus closed, proprietary systems. Chinese labs have been shipping increasingly capable open-weight models in rapid succession, including GLM-5.2, Kimi K3, and DeepSeek V4, and their availability is forcing developers, investors, and policymakers to rethink assumptions about who leads in AI and how 1.
Why Open Models Are Gaining Ground
The appeal of these releases is straightforward: they are free to download, modify, and deploy, giving startups, researchers, and enterprises outside the small circle of well-funded American labs a way to build on frontier-level technology without paying for access or committing to a single vendor's ecosystem 1. That accessibility is already rippling into adjacent industries. Bank of America pointed to the emergence of Kimi K3 and other Chinese open-source releases as evidence supporting its bullish outlook on memory chipmakers, arguing that a proliferation of open models — many of which are large and memory-intensive — should boost demand for high-bandwidth memory and benefit companies like Micron Technology 2. In other words, the open-source wave is not just a software story; it is beginning to shape hardware demand forecasts as well.
Hardware and Infrastructure Reactions
The open-versus-closed debate is also playing out at the infrastructure level. AMD CEO Lisa Su used a recent AI conference appearance to publicly defend open-source AI development, doing so in the aftermath of a security breach at Hugging Face that was reportedly caused by OpenAI-built agents — an incident that gave critics of open ecosystems fresh ammunition 4. Su's remarks, paired with AMD's unveiling of new hardware aimed at AI workloads, signal that major chipmakers see strategic value in aligning themselves with open development even as security concerns mount 4. Separately, the broader open-source hardware movement notched its own milestone: 3mdeb's release of Dasharo v0.9.0 brought open-source firmware, built on Coreboot and openSIL, to AMD's AM5 desktop platform for the first time, extending the openness debate beyond AI models into the firmware layer that underpins computing itself 3.
Skepticism and Geopolitical Risk
Not everyone views China's open-source push benignly. A dissenting take frames these free, high-performing models as a strategic maneuver rather than generosity, warning that widespread adoption could create dependency on Chinese-designed systems, embed censorship into global information flows, and hand Beijing geopolitical leverage over Western technology stacks 5. That critique underscores why the open-versus-closed question can't be separated entirely from the U.S.-China contest — even as the technical battle lines increasingly run through licensing terms and model weights rather than national borders alone.
